We're recruiting for a Project Coordinator to support the successful delivery of renewable energy installations from initial handover through to completion. This is a varied role involving customer communication, project administration, scheduling and coordinating key project documentation.
You'll be the main point of contact for customers throughout the process, providing updates, answering queries and ensuring projects progress smoothly and efficiently.
Key Responsibilities:- Managing customer communications via phone and email
- Providing regular project updates
- Coordinating project documentation and administration
- Supporting installation projects from handover through to completion
- Liaising with customers, suppliers and internal teams
- Maintaining accurate records and project information
- Previous administration, coordination or customer service experience
- Excellent communication and organisational skills
- Strong attention to detail
- Confident managing multiple tasks and priorities
- Positive, proactive and customer-focused approach
- Previous experience within renewables, construction, utilities or technical environments would be beneficial, but full training will be provided.
